Nature Getaway πŸŒ³πŸŒΏπŸƒ

Escape the hustle and bustle of daily life by surrounding yourself with nature. With many national parks and state forests open for the public, camping is a great way to get close to nature without overspending.

Camping gear can be quite expensive, but you can always rent or borrow from a friend. If you’re not a fan of sleeping in a tent, consider renting a cabin or camper-van for a more comfortable experience.

Go on long hikes, take a dip in a nearby river, and have a campfire under the starry sky. Don’t forget to pack your s’mores ingredients!

Beach Bumming πŸ–οΈπŸŒŠβ›±οΈ

Who said a beach vacation had to be expensive? There are many affordable beach towns in the US where you can soak up the sun, read a book and enjoy the salty breeze.

Look for hotels or Airbnbs that are close to the beach and have a kitchenette so you can prepare your own meals. Skip the pricey restaurants and instead, pack a picnic and enjoy it on the beach.

Take long walks on the beach, collect seashells, and build sandcastles. Bask in the sun and rejuvenate your soul.

City Explorer πŸ’πŸŒ†πŸ‘€

Explore your own city! This is the perfect staycation for those who want to experience the city life without spending a ton of money.

Research free events and activities in the city, such as visiting museums, going on a self-guided walking tour, or attending a free concert.

If you want to get a truly authentic experience, book an Airbnb in a neighborhood you haven’t explored before. Head to the local coffee shops and restaurants and get a taste of the culture and cuisine.
